               ORDER

% 20.05.2022

1. This hearing has been done through hybrid mode.

2. On behalf of Defendant No.2- Department of Pharmaceuticals, Ministry of Chemicals and Fertilizers further 2 days' time is sought to obtain instructions and file an affidavit in terms of the previous order dated 11th May, 2022. Let the said affidavit be filed by 24th May, 2022 with advance copy to counsels for all the parties.

3. Ms. Rajeshwari, ld. Counsel for Defendant No.1 submits that the Defendant has not obtained any manufacturing license in respect of the drug "NILOTINIB". Defendant No.1 shall file an affidavit detailing its categorical stand in respect of licenses applied for or obtained in respect of the drug Signature Not Verified Digitally Signed By:DEVANSHU JOSHI Signing Date:23.05.2022 18:01:48 "NILOTINIB".

4. List this matter on 26th May, 2022. A senior official from the Department of Pharmaceuticals, Ministry of Chemicals and Fertilizers shall join the Court proceedings virtually or remain present in Court on the next date.
